欢迎访问ic37.com |
会员登录 免费注册
发布采购

广泛应用于嵌入式系统的8位微控制器 AT89C52-12JC

发布日期:2024-09-16
AT89C52-12JC

芯片AT89C52-12JC的概述

AT89C52-12JC 是一款广泛应用于嵌入式系统的8位微控制器,属于Atmel(现为Microchip Technology)公司生产的89系列单片机。该芯片采用5V的电源电压,内置的Flash存储器为用户提供了高达8KB的可编程存储区。由于其优秀的性能和灵活的编程方式,AT89C52-12JC 在各类中小型电子产品中表现出色,尤其适合用于控制和监测等应用。

芯片AT89C52-12JC的详细参数

AT89C52-12JC 的主要技术规格如下:

- 核心架构:8位 - 存储器: - Flash:8 KB(可编程) - RAM:256 字节 - EEPROM:未集成 - I/O 引脚:32 个 - 时钟频率:最高可达 12 MHz - 工作电压:4.0V - 5.5V - 指令系统:支持 111 条指令 - 定时器/计数器:2 个 16 位定时器 - 串行通信接口:满双工 UART 接口 - 中断系统:5 个中断源 - 封装:多种封装形式如 DIP、PLCC 等

芯片AT89C52-12JC的厂家、包装、封装

AT89C52-12JC 是由知名半导体企业 Atmel(现为 Microchip Technology)所生产。该芯片常见的封装形式包括 DIP-40、PLCC-44 和 QFP-44。不同的封装形式满足不同场合的需求,DIP 封装适合较为传统的插拔试验,而 SMD 封装则适合现代化的自动化生产线。

在包装方面,AT89C52-12JC 通常以单片形式供应,也可以配备在开发套件中以便于用户进行原型开发。另外,厂家也会提供详细的技术手册和编程指南,帮助用户更好地理解和应用该芯片。

芯片AT89C52-12JC的引脚和电路图说明

AT89C52-12JC 的引脚分布如下:

1. VCC:电源正极。 2. GND:电源负极。 3. P0.0 - P0.7:端口0,双向I/O端口。 4. P1.0 - P1.7:端口1,双向I/O端口。 5. P2.0 - P2.7:端口2,双向I/O端口。 6. P3.0 - P3.7:端口3,双向I/O端口及中断源。 7. EAV:编程和读写信号。 8. XE1 和 XE2:外部晶振引脚。

下图所示为其简化的电路图:

+-------------------------+ | | VCC | P0.0 P0.1 P0.2 P0.3|--- P0 | P0.4 P0.5 P0.6 P0.7| | P1.0 P1.1 P1.2 P1.3|--- P1 | P1.4 P1.5 P1.6 P1.7| | P2.0 P2.1 P2.2 P2.3|--- P2 | P2.4 P2.5 P2.6 P2.7| | P3.0 P3.1 P3.2 P3.3|--- P3 | P3.4 P3.5 P3.6 P3.7| GND | XTAL1 XTAL2 | +-------------------------+

引脚的配置使得 AT89C52-12JC 能够灵活地接入各种外围设备,如传感器、显示模块、执行器等。

芯片AT89C52-12JC的使用案例

AT89C52-12JC 在许多应用场合都表现得非常出色。以下是几个基于该芯片的实用案例,展示了其多样化的应用潜力。

1. 智能家居控制器:AT89C52-12JC 能够作为一个智能家居的控制核心,可以通过传感器读取环境数据,并控制家电。当家庭环境温度过高时,控制空调自动开启;在湿度超过设定阈值时,自动开启除湿设备。此外,该系统可通过手机 APP 进行远程控制和监控。

2. 电子秤设计:在商超或餐饮行业的电子秤中,AT89C52-12JC 可以用于读取传感器数据,并将其通过液晶显示模块显示出来。用户只需将物品放置在称重平台上,单片机即会实时计算并显示重量。

3. 温湿度监测仪:结合不同的温湿度传感器,利用 AT89C52-12JC 可设计一个实时监测环境温度和湿度的设备。数据通过 LCD 或 LED 显示模块可视化,并具备数据记录和报警功能,以便于用户监测异常情况。

4. 小型机器人控制系统:AT89C52-12JC 也被广泛应用于教育领域的机器人项目。通过控制舵机电机和传感器,该芯片能够实现简单的移动、避障等功能,用户可以轻松上手进行基础的编程和调试,为学生提供实践机会。

5. 数控设备:在数控机床和激光雕刻机等设备中,AT89C52-12JC 可用于位置控制、参数设置和操作逻辑的实现。借助微控制器内置的定时器和中断功能,可以实现高精度的控制,满足设备对实时性的需求。

通过这些案例,我们可以看到 AT89C52-12JC 在各种场合的适应性与灵活性,性能足以满足许多实际应用中对微控制器的要求,促使其在嵌入式设计中成为一种受到广泛欢迎的选择。

 复制成功!